Abstract (EN)
Key Words: Fundamental Unit, Continued Fractions, Infinite Continued Fractions, Periodic Infinite Continued Fractions , Pure Periodic Infinite Continued Fractions, Fibonacci Numbers, Lucas Numbers, Pell and Pell-Lucas Numbers, Diophantine EquationsThis study consists of five chapters.In the first chapter, some basic definations and theorems are given.In the second chapter, units in the real quadratic fields were examined.In the third chapter, finite continued fractions, infinite continued fractions, periodic continued fractions, pure periodic infinite continued fractions, and infinite continuous fraction expansion of ?d were investigated.In the fourth chapter, the fundamental units of the real quadratic fields were calculated.In the fifth chapter, solutions of some diophantine equations were given.
